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47 40 90742546 799 2262746
8402 78258995189 7966298957
8402 78258995189 7966298957
66626188 34920 70795043
All about undefined
Interested in learning more?
8402 78258995189 7966298957
66626188 34920 70795043
See more
66649 2528937 33611
1902041 031542 09775225894 91527 097
See more
42830265826 28807027630
3862596 30858130 034
See more